How African Business Leader Tony Elumelu Is Celebrating Wife Awele At 52

African business leader Tony Onyemaechi Elumelu is specially treating his wife, Mrs. Awele Vivien Elumelu today.

And the reason for this is straightforward, the mother of his seven children – born on June 23, 1964 – just turned 52.

Evidently happy about the development, the chairman of leading African conglomerates – Heirs Holdings, United Bank for Africa (UBA), and Transnational Corporation (Transcorp) – took to his social media handles to openly express the kind of affection he has for her.

“Happy birthday to my lovely wife ❤️👩‍❤️‍👨” Mr. Elumelu’s short post, decorated with beautiful images of his Medical Doctor wife and Chairperson of Avon Healthcare Limited read.
